This Big Ass DIY Camera Takes Pictures on 3 Foot Long Film

Darren Samuelson wanted bigger pictures so built himself a ginormous camera that he aptly named Darren’s Great Big Camera. When fully extended, the camera is taller than the average man (6 feet long) and shoots on 14×36-inch negatives. NBD.

It’s definitely an impressive piece of work, that required a lot of audibles, tweaking and patience while building. Samuelson started the project because he wanted to take pictures larger than 8×10-inches without going digital—I guess creating something as big as this made sense. The camera is using x-ray film which is apparently much cheaper than regular film.

After a few trial and errors, it looks like Samuelson has found his groove and the pictures are starting to look great. Check out his Great Big Camera here. [Darren’s Great Big Camera via MAKE]
